Overweight and obesity, often defined by a high BMI, are associated with a heightened risk of various health complications. Conversely, being underweight, or having a BMI too low, can also raise concerns. However, identifying normal weight should not be solely based on this one metric.

BMI calculator tools are widely accessible online and in many healthcare settings. These tools provide a quick assessment based on height and weight. But it's important to remember that BMI is a simplified measure that doesn't capture the entirety of an individual's body composition. Muscle mass, for example, can significantly impact a person's BMI, potentially misclassifying them as overweight or underweight.

The NHLBI and similar organizations emphasize a holistic approach to assessing an individual's health status. Factors such as waist circumference, body fat percentage, and overall lifestyle choices, including dietary habits and activity levels, are all considered. A detailed medical evaluation is often needed for a comprehensive understanding.

Furthermore, the weight category classifications—underweight, normal weight, overweight, and obesity—are based on established norms and benchmarks. However, these norms aren't universally applicable and can sometimes be overly simplified. Different ethnicities and populations might exhibit varying physiological characteristics.
